NFL comparisons to actual NFL players suck most of the time. Here are some comparisons that actually make sense.
NFL Combine in the books, the league now has one of its last major information-gathering opportunities for the prospects of ...
"The way (Keaschall is) wired, he walks away from you and you think, ‘That guy's going to play in the big leagues.’" ...